Leica Geovid Max 10×42 Applied Ballistics Laser Rangefinding Binoculars
The Leica Geovid Max 10×42 Applied Ballistics Laser Rangefinding Binoculars (40831) combine premium optical performance, advanced laser ranging, and integrated ballistic calculations into a complete field system for hunting and long-range shooting. Designed for hunters and shooters who demand accurate information in demanding conditions, the Geovid Max brings together high-transmission optics, a next-generation laser rangefinder, environmental sensors, and onboard Applied Ballistics technology in one durable, connected platform.
The 10×42 optical system delivers 91% light transmission, a 342-foot field of view at 1,000 yards, and 16mm of eye relief. Its Perger-Porro prism system, HDC multilayer coating, and AquaDura coating help provide clear viewing and reliable performance in changing conditions. The magnesium, nitrogen-filled housing is waterproof to a depth of 16 feet, while the internal focusing system and adjustable interpupillary distance of 56–74mm support comfortable use in the field.
The integrated laser rangefinder provides fast, accurate distance measurements, ranging reflective targets out to 8,200 yards, trees to 4,600 yards, and deer-sized targets to 1,600 yards. The system measures in as little as 0.3 seconds and includes selectable scan and single-measurement modes. Programmable first, best, and last target logic provides flexibility when ranging through complex terrain or vegetation, while the equivalent horizontal range (EHR) output helps account for angle when evaluating a target.
Applied Ballistics in the Leica Geovid Max 10×42 LRF Binoculars
Applied Ballistics is integrated directly into the Leica Geovid Max 10×42, providing real-time ballistic solutions including equivalent horizontal range, elevation and windage corrections, holdover information, and WEZ (Weapon Employment Zone) data. The system supports customized ballistic profiles and connects to the Leica Ballistics app through Bluetooth. Users can also connect compatible Kestrel and Calypso devices for wind inputs, while GPS target marking through onX, BaseMap, and Google Maps helps connect ranging data with navigation and location information.
The fully customizable 640×480 active-matrix microLED display lets users prioritize the information they need, from distance and ballistic data to environmental conditions and wind. Selectable circle, square, and cross reticle shapes provide additional display flexibility. The Leica Geovid Max 10×42 also supports connectivity with compatible Garmin and Apple watches, Kestrel HUD, and other devices within Leica’s open ecosystem.
